Bioethanol Fire - An Alternative to Traditional Fireplaces

Bioethanol fires are an excellent alternative to traditional fireplaces since it does not require a flue and chimney. This makes it perfect for new builds as well as homes that are already in use, Shepherds Huts, Conservatories and even work sheds.

They do not produce smoke, ash or carcinogenic fumes so are much safer than traditional fireplaces. A one litre of fuel can last 3 hours when the heat output is at its peak.

Cleanliness

Ethanol fireplaces, also referred to as Biofires or bioethanol fires are a cleaner alternative to traditional wood or gas burning heating. The primary difference is that they don't require a flue or chimney and instead burn clean-burning fuel called Bioethanol, which is produced from the fermentation of waste products from crops like maize and sugar cane. Bioethanol is a "green" fuel that is made from renewable plant sugars, starches, and is refined and distilled to enhance its performance in burning. Burning bioethanol produces CO2 and water vapour, which are less harmful to the air than particulates or smoke generated by burning wood or other solid fuels.

The appeal of these fires that burn cleanly is that they create an amazing flame effect and radiant heat, without any hassle or maintenance of a conventional fire. They are easy to set up and operate and can be used by simply being put into the fuel box of the appliance. Fuel is added to the burner using the specially designed squeezy bottle that doesn't drip. The fuel is then ignited to create a stunning flame effect. As it burns, the flames heat up the surrounding glass creating a warm, cozy atmosphere.
